GAGEN, NORMAN Enson Club; May Dance Committee. uSo umfected, so compoxed a mind. Norman is a quiet, easy-going, though persevering student. He spent four successful years with us and intends to continue his studies in college. Like all young men of his character, iihitthiug his wagon to a star, Norman will, through his persistency, establish himself in the coveted position of his ambitions, that of a lawyer. GARTNER, EUGENE Enson Club. llSz'lmce when other: brawl To him is the 56H speech of 41 .n While not much heard from, Eugene is vefy energetic, and his pleasant dis posrcion commands his classmates, admiration and respect. ' GOLDBERG, REBECCA S. A. 9.; Pre-Le'nten Dance Committee. btudz'ou: of mm, andfand of humblejhings. After three energetic and successful years at East Night, Little Rebecca is infused with an ardent desire to continue her studies at U. C. We know that success will crown her efforts, and that she will easily distinguish- herself, becaus: of the Whole and undivided attention giveh to her class work. 25

DOERMANN, GEORGE CirculatingiManager, The Rostrum; Enson Club; E. N A. A.; Football Committee; Boat Ride Committee; Pre-Lenten Dance Committee. llGreat is the reward of those who iremain firm. George has been faithful in his studies and attendance throughout his. entire academic career. He has also been active in all school affairs. As for notions, George has all kinds. He is connected with a large dryhgoods firm as salesman, and we do not doubt but that some day he will beacme a ktmerchant prince. ECKERT, WALTER May Dance Committee. I! wise head and a. silent tongug are companions. Knowing that East Night is the best place to get a good running start for U. C., Walter joined us last fall. He is now on the way to the University to pre- pare to be a mechanical engineer. Success be with you, Walter. FENDER, FLORA Essay Contest; President, P. A. 1...; S. A. 9.; Prc-Lsntzn Dance Committee. Size is a maiden gentle and kind, whom modaty, Her greatest charm, Jellies on others like a great calm. The refined atmosphere which surrounds Flora constantly, elevated her in the estimation of her companions. Her class work was of the highest order and we hold her in high esteem both as a chum and fellow student. That your future will be successful, is the wish of the Class of l19, Flora. 24

GROSS, ETHEL ViceePresident, S. A. 9.; P. A. L.; Dramatic Club; Ianuary Dance Committee. Of Aer brightface one glance will trace A picture on the brain. Ethel is the songbird of our class. She has enlivened the P. A. L. gatherings by her singing. We feel confident of her success as a great singer in the near future. She has Completed twa years of commercial work at East Night in addi- tion to her academic course. Success, Ethel. GROSS, SELMA May Dance Committee. i'Her lovelineu I never knew Until she smiled on me. A sweet, unassuming nature has Selma. Rumor has it that she intends to specialize in Latin and we know that if Virgil or Cicero were alive, they WOuld marvel at the ease with which she gives her constructions. Keep it up, Selma. HALLER, CONRAD May Dance Committee. iin's words were sized :qfter Than leavesfram'the pine. Conrad, optimistic and good-natured, has been with us four years. We wonh dered at times why he was so Conspicuous by his absence from school activities. We found that he was engaged in a serious courtship, which inevitably took all his spare time. He later entered into a blissful matrimonial career. Congratu- lations are a bit late, Conrad, but as the proverb states, iiBetter late than never. iiN'est-ce pas P - 26
